All rights reserved. http://www.usgwarchives.net/copyright.htm http://www.usgwarchives.net/pa/blair/ _________________________________________ MAXWELL M. WERTZ The Rev. Maxwell M. Wertz, 53, pastor of Trinity Missionary Church, Springfield, Ohio, a native of Altoona, died at 9:30 a.m. yesterday, July 19, 1976, at his home. Rev. Wertz had been in failing health for the past eight months. He served as pastor of the missionary churches for more than 19 years. In addition to Springfield, he served in Greensburg and Phillipsburg, Ohio. Rev. Wertz was a graduate of Altoona High School and Bethel College, Mishawaka, Ind. During World II, he served as an Army medic. He was born Oct. 14, 1922, a son of Maxwell W. and Lillian (Hileman) Wertz, and married Norma Ort on Feb., 1952. Surviving are his wife, two children, Dennis, at home and Deidra of Springfield, Ohio, and a brother and three sisters, David, Mrs. Margaretta Russell and Mrs. Ethel Endress of Duncansville, and Mrs. Erdene Shoenfelt of Hollidaysburg. Friends will be received in the Williams Funeral Home, Springfield, Ohio, from 2 to 4 and 6 to 9 p.m., tomorrow.
